Base64エンコード・デコードツール

テキストや画像のBase64変換を瞬時に、かつ安全に行えます。エンジニアやデザイナーのためのプロ仕様ツールです。

クライアントサイド処理(セキュア)
Encoding Mode
Input 0 B
Output 0 B

Base64エンコード・デコードツールとは?

「Base64エンコード・デコードツール」は、テキストや画像ファイルをBase64形式に変換(エンコード)したり、逆にBase64文字列を元のデータに復元(デコード)したりできるプロフェッショナル向けツールです。 Web開発やAPI通信の現場で頻繁に必要となる変換を、ブラウザ完結で安全に行うことができます。

主な機能

  • テキスト・画像の両対応: 任意のテキストデータに加え、画像ファイルをドラッグ&ドロップするだけでData URI形式に自動変換します。
  • プロ向け整形オプション: エンコード結果をそのままCSSの `url()` やHTMLの `` タグとしてコピーできるため、実装の手間を大幅に削減します。
  • URLセーフ対応: 記号(+, /)をURLで安全に扱える文字(-, _)に変換。トークンやパラメータ生成に最適です。
  • リアルタイム・オーバーヘッド表示: 変換後のファイルサイズ増加率を即座に計算。パフォーマンス設計に役立ちます。

主な利用シーン

  • アセットの埋め込み: アイコンやロゴをCSS/HTMLに直接記述し、HTTPリクエスト数を減らしてページロードを高速化したい場合。
  • データの安全な転送: JSONやメールなどのテキスト専用プロトコルでバイナリ(画像等)を送受信したい場合。
  • 認証・デバッグ: Basic認証ヘッダーやJWTの中身を解析、あるいは生成したい場合。

Base64の仕組みについて

Base64は、バイナリデータを64種類の印字可能な英数字のみを用いて表現する方式です。データ量は元の約1.33倍に増加しますが、あらゆる環境で「文字化け」や「欠損」なくデータを扱えるようになるのが最大の特徴です。

ツール一覧に戻る